During a bilateral meeting with Poland’s president, President Donald Trump rejected claims of inaction on Russia and referenced sanctions costing Moscow hundreds of billions.
President Donald Trump lashed out at a reporter who claimed he has taken „no action“ against Russia since taking office on Wednesday.
The exchange came as Trump was holding a bilateral meeting with Polish President Karol Nawrocki at the White House. Trump took questions from the press, and one reporter with a Polish outlet claimed Trump has so far been all talk in his criticism of Russian President Vladimir Putin.
„You have expressed many times your frustration and disappointment with Putin, but there’s no action since you took your office“, the reporter said.
„How do you know there’s no action? Really? Wait, wait, who are you with?“ Trump responded.
„I’m with Polish media“, the reporter responded.
